NLC Threatens Mass Resistance Against Further Hike in Electricity
Nigeria Labour Congress, NLC, yesterday urged the Federal Government to jettison any planned hike in electricity tariff under any guise, threatening to lead mass resistance against further such increases in tariff.
This came as it threatened to shut down operations of telecommunications companies should they fail to implement the 35 Percent hike in tariff agreed with the Government as against the 50 per cent earlier approved through the Nigeria Communications Commission, NCC.
NLC in a communique at the end of its National Executive Council, NEC, meeting in in Yola, Adamawa State, said members of NEC unequivocally rejected “the ongoing sham reclassification of electricity consumers by the NERC which seeks to forcefully migrate consumers from lower bands to Band A under the guise of service improvement while, in reality, imposing unjustified extortion on the masses.”
